Travnik Fortress

Ideal: Travellers interested in fortresses, Ottoman history and smaller historic towns

Travnik Fortress overlooks the Lašva valley and reflects the city's defensive history from the medieval and Ottoman periods. Views from the walls extend across the town and surrounding mountains, while the lower centre, historic religious buildings and Plava Voda complete the route. Travnik's role as the seat of Ottoman governors in Bosnia helps explain its concentration of heritage. Allow enough time for the sloping walk between the fortress and the centre.
